is_selinux_enabled − check whether SELinux is enabled
is_selinux_mls_enabled − check whether SELinux is enabled for (Multi Level Securty) MLS
#include <selinux/selinux.h>
int is_selinux_enabled();
int is_selinux_mls_enabled();
is_selinux_enabled() returns 1 if SELinux is running or 0 if it is not. On error, −1 is returned.
is_selinux_mls_enabled() returns 1 if SELinux is running in MLS mode or 0 if it is not.
selinux(8)